A multiple award-winning book! • A Kirkus Reviews Best Book • Texas Bluebonnet 2021-2022 Master List • A New York Public Library Best Book • Denver Public Library’s Best and Brightest 2020 Poetry List • ALSC Summer Reading SelectionIdeal for fans of Jack Prelutsky and Shel Silverstein, this collection of hilarious poems is perfect for any young reader who likes to read — and laugh!
This funny poetry book is full of unusual characters: panda and pangolin musicians, show more mail-order eggs that hatch dinosaurs (surprise!), ten aliens with a garden-gnome pal, a robot uncle, lots and lots of dragons, and a professor who uses his Page Machine to travel to multiple pages within the book. Vikram Madan's ingenious poems take many forms, from limerick to rebus to a fill-in-the-blank poem that offers more than 13.8 billion funny combinations. All feature clever wordplay, impeccable rhythm and rhyme, and riotous punchlines. This is a quirky collection of poems that readers will laugh their way through again and again. show less
